Home Remedies For Dandruff Cure:
1. Coconut Oil & Lemon Massage
Coconut oil nourishes your hair, while lemon juice helps to treat dandruff at home without using harmful chemicals. Given below is the easiest dandruff home remedy:
Step 1: Heat 2 tablespoons of coconut oil and mix it with equal amounts of lemon juice. Step 2: Massage your scalp gently with the mixture.
Step 3: Leave it on for 20 minutes before rinsing if off without shampoo.

Apple Cider Vinegar
Take two tablespoons of apple cider vinegar.
Mix an equal amount of water and 15-20 drops of tea tree oil in it.
Apply it onto your scalp and massage. Rinse your hair after a few minutes.
Follow this natural treatment two or three times a week.

Dandruff is a chronic condition. It's not curable but it's controlable with anti-fungal agents. Curd and lemon does take care of it for a short duration but you need definite treatment so that it's not bothersome.
